Job Description
This position is listed on behalf of a partner company, who manages all applications and next steps. Our partner is looking for a Prescription Experience Specialist based in the United States.
This role is focused on making the prescription journey as smooth, accurate, and efficient as possible for providers and patients.
You’ll own a portfolio of newly onboarded practices while also managing escalated cases that require deeper investigation and follow-through.
The position combines case management, healthcare operations, problem-solving, and high-touch customer support.
You’ll navigate prior authorizations, insurance plans, pharmacies, and affordability programs to help prescriptions move forward without unnecessary delays.
Success requires strong judgment, attention to detail, and the ability to manage complex cases independently in a fast-paced environment.
You’ll work closely with providers, patients, and internal teams, becoming a trusted point of accountability when issues arise.
Strong performers will have opportunities to grow toward Customer Success responsibilities as the function expands.
- Own the end-to-end prescription experience for newly onboarded provider practices and escalated cases, from initial submission through final determination.
- Navigate prior authorizations across insurance plans, pharmacies, and affordability programs to ensure prescriptions are processed accurately and efficiently.
- Investigate cases from end to end, identify stalled or unresolved issues, coordinate with the appropriate internal teams, and maintain ownership through resolution.
- Proactively identify and address potential issues before they create prescription delays, working directly with providers, health plans, pharmacies, and other stakeholders when needed.
- Communicate with patients and providers through phone, email, and text, providing knowledgeable, responsive, and empathetic support.
- De-escalate sensitive or high-stress situations while ensuring patients and providers feel heard, supported, and confident in the resolution process.
- Maintain exceptional accuracy across all casework, recognizing the importance of precision when working with prescriptions, insurance information, and patient needs.
- Identify recurring patterns across prescription cases and translate those findings into practical guidance, process improvements, or escalations for internal teams.
- Learn and use proprietary software and operational tools efficiently while adapting to evolving workflows and processes.
- Exercise sound judgment when determining whether to intervene, escalate an issue, or allow an existing workflow to continue.
- Collaborate cross-functionally to resolve complex patient and provider issues and ensure a seamless prescription experience.
